CASE STUDY
1 . Automatic speech recognition
and spoken dialogue
processing technology
We are pursuing development of various communication
related technologies, such as voice translation that reflects
information about the speaker and intention, automatic speech
recognition systems that can understand accents, and chatbot
auto-response technology. Totto is an android designed to
resemble the female actress and talent Testuko Kuroyanagi,
which is not only equipped with dialogue knowledge built from
a large database, but also loaded with the personality learned
from Kuroyanagi’s broadcast data. Natural interactions are
realized through the use of highly precise automatic speech
recognition and highly realistic voice synthesis technology, as
well as speech dialogue processing technology, allowing users
to enjoy conversations that seem like talking to Kuroyanagi
herself. Even more natural conversation is achieved by
combining robot control and automatic generation of motions
ⓒ 2017 totto production committee related to the conversation.

2 . Spatio-temporal
multidimensional
collective data analysis
By analyzing large amounts of data about the movement
of people and cars, AI becomes able to effortlessly make
temporal and spatial predictions. These efforts are based
on an approach known as spatio-temporal multidimensional
collective data analysis. For example, together with NTT
DoCoMo, we are conducting tests of a “Near-Future Crowd
Prediction” system that can anticipate the amount of people
in an area several hours in advance. In another practical
approach, AI taxis that use predictions of travel patterns
to match taxi supply and demand have already been
shown to boost revenue, and AI is also anticipated to be
implemented for car sharing and “on-demand bus” services
that dynamically manage the operation of buses based on
demand predictions.

CASE STUDY
1. Ultra-realistic communication with "Kirari!"
“Kirari!” is an ultra-realistic
communication technology
that can faithfully transmit
spaces synchronously in
real time to multiple halls or
performance venues, creating
the same sense of immersion
as live venues. Kirari! makes
possible multi- angle video
of isolated objects and real-
time sampling of competition audio. For example during sporting events, life-size 3D images of athletes can be projected onto a
stage, with sound image localization and multi-angle image display towards both sides, instantaneously reproducing reality as
if the audience were watching the game in person. Combining sensing of real-life performers with media processing even makes
it possible to produce joint performances between present-day and past performers that would otherwise be impossible. In this
manner, we aim to enable audiences to experience a wide variety of ultra-realistic content that transcends the limitations of
space and time.

2 . Angle-free object recognition technology


Research is progressing on technology
that can identify objects from indirect
angles when searching for images of
buildings, products, and other things,
bringing changes to sightseeing,
commerce, and exhibitions. Angle-free
object recognition technology, which
we have been researching since 2015,
has made it possible to recognize and
present relevant information about three-
dimensional objects with a high degree
of precision regardless of the angle from
which the object is captured. Specific
use cases include venue and tourist
information, as well as digital stamp rallies in which users can collect stamps by pointing the camera at a specific spot, and
electronic manuals that are displayed when the camera is pointed at a device. It is now possible to recognize a wide range of
non-rigid products such as textile products and products in soft packaging . This could make it possible to reduce tasks such as
merchandise management and checkout, and also link items with product information.

CASE STUDY
1. Point of Atmosphere (PoA)
In the future, we believe it will no longer be necessary for
people to pay direct attention to devices, as various close-at-
hand items watch over our lives. For example, rooms will be
filled with various connected ICT devices that could naturally
convey the likelihood of rain by causing a raincoat hanging
on the wall shake or by making the floor appear wet. We
call this kind of action “Point of Atmosphere (PoA),” which
improves digital experience through natural interactions that
harmoniously connect people with their surroundings without
disturbing their primary activities. We will continue to develop
this technology while utilizing sensing and media processing
technologies, so that everyone can benefit from the Smart
World regardless of IT literacy.

2. Hidden stereo technology


When someone looks at a stereo image without wearing
3D glasses, the images from different viewpoints overlap
to produce a double image. Viewers must choose between
2D and 3D images. We used a visual mechanism that
plays a role in human depth perception to develop stereo
image generation technology that preserves 2D display
compatibility. This technology generates images for the left
and right eyes by adding and subtracting disparity-inducer
patterns that provide depth information to the human eye.
Viewers without 3D glasses can watch clear images, while
viewers wearing 3D glasses are able to enjoy 3D images.
This makes it possible for people who want to watch in 2D
and 3D to enjoy the same content in the same place. There
are previous examples of 3D image technology that maintains
compatibility with 2D display, but NTT was the first to develop
technology that makes it possible to display 2D images that
are clear even when viewed without wearing glasses.

CASE STUDY
1. Botnet detection from network flow
In order to protect against botnets
that launch large -scale cyber
attacks by exploiting PCs and IoT
devices infected with malware,
it is necessary to understand the
entirety of botnet activity. We are
using network flow data to detect
botnets. Large -scale analysis
of traffic, focusing on network
flow from carriers, ISPs, and
datacenters, allows us to gain
an overall picture of the botnets
used in DDoS attacks and spam
mail transmission. Botnet components that are mingled with normal communications are analyzed from various angles by multiple
detection algorithms, and the data is visualized to reveal the entire botnet structure and evolution over time.

2. Malicious website detection from web traffic


We are building a collaborative
platform for cyber defense
tec hnology (LRR ) to protec t
against increasingly
sophisticated and varied
cyber at tacks. This platform
includes features such as URL
inspection and domain name
analysis and categorization
that are useful for detecting and
analyzing malicious sites that
plant malware when accessed.
URL inspection employs
defensive technologies including
honeypots, domain name analysis, structural analysis of malicious websites, and longitudinal data of attacks. In addition, we are
working on collecting and utilizing intelligence regarding malicious websites that deceive and attack users.

CASE STUDY
1 . Optical interconnect
technology for AI
As IoT and other trends lead to explosive growth
of data, and data processing becomes more
complex due to factors such as multiple data
sources, we will enter the post-Moore’s Law era
when it is no longer possible to improve processing
capabilities through the continual build-up of
computing resources. Rather than simply speeding
up communication hardware, we are working
on AI optical interconnect technology in which
hardware and software function together in order
to dramatically shorten the processing time of
large-scale distributed deep learning by applying
technology cultivated in optical communication to
information processing.

2. Optical information processing chip with


nanophotonics technology
Present-day information processing devices, such
as personal computers and mobile phones, use
huge amounts of logic gates based on electronic
circuit technology. The information processing
societ y of the future requires even higher
functioning logic gates, but we know that we are
approaching limits in terms of speed and energy
consumption. In order to address these needs, we
are hard at work creating information processing
chips that use light. Already, we have performed
nano-scale processing of semiconductors to
close light into exceptionally small spaces
at the nanometer scale, and create memory,
transistors, and other basic constituent functions
of information processing devices with light. Use
of light should enable the creation of high-speed
computing infrastructure with ultra-low energy consumption that is impossible to achieve using traditional electronics. Integrated
with future light-based communications technology, it will also contribute to an innovative information processing society.

CASE STUDY
1. Space division
m u l t i p l ex i n g o p t i c a l
fibers
Continued evolution of optical fibers is
necessary in order to overcome the capacity
limits of conventional technology. In order to
accommodate a 30~50% annual increase in
internet traffic, we are pursuing research into
space division multiplexing optical fibers that
can expand transmission capacity. This entails
realizing multi-core optical fibers that contain
multiple cores and few-mode fibers that use
multiple optical transmission modes. We are currently investigating integrated few-mode multi-core fiber structures. We have
already successfully produced optical fibers with more than 100 spatial optical channels. Going forward, we will work towards
the introduction of petabyte-class transmission systems in the late 2020s by developing additional basic technologies and
standardizing optical fibers for space division multiplexing.

2 . I n t e g r a t e d o p t i c a l f r o n t e n d d ev i c e
By developing ultra-wide band integrated optical front-end device
technology and our own highly precise method for calibrating multi-
level coded signals, we were the first in the world to successfully use
wavelength division multiplexed optical transmission to transmit one
terabit per wavelength per second. Furthermore, we were the first in
the world to succeed in transmitting over 800 km by multiplexing 35
wavelengths. This experiment entailed introducing analog multiplexed
(AMUX) functions into silicon CMOS circuit and the optical front-
end circuit unit and making it easier to assemble the circuits. We
achieved a speed 10 times faster than the systems currently in use. In
the future, this should contribute greatly to social change as a core
technology of innovative networks.

CASE STUDY
1. Back-to-earth battery
As IoT technology becomes commonplace, trillions of
devices will be put into the world, some of which will never
be recovered and simply discarded. In order to reduce
the associated environmental impact, we began research
into batteries assembled from only bio-derived carbon and
fertilizer components that can biodegrade and return to
the earth. Development began in 2016 and a prototype
was completed in 2017 under the trademark "Back-to-earth
battery.” Conventional batteries can adversely affect the soil
when discarded. However, the materials used in the back-
toearth battery contain the same ingredients as fertilizer, and
have been shown not to disrupt plant growth even when the
battery cannot be recovered. Low performance means that
uses are limited, but performance improvements and a wider
range of applications are expected in the future.

2. Artificial photosynthesis technology


In order to reduce carbon dioxide
emissions and prevent global warming, we
are researching artificial photosynthesis
technology that produces various substances
from water and carbon dioxide in the same
way as plant photosynthesis. Ar tificial
photosynthesis generates hydrogen and
numerous carbon compounds such as formic
acid, methane and methanol, which could be
used as industrial raw materials and fuel gas.
We are developing artificial photosynthesis
technology using epitaxal growth technology
and catalyst technology that came out
of R&D related to optical communication
and batteries. This artificial photosynthesis
technology has already been demonstrated to be capable of exceeding the photosynthetic conversion efficiency of plants, and
in 2016 achieved 100 hours of continuous testing. Although prior efforts have focused on the production of hydrogen, in the
future we aim to generate carbon compounds at scale in order to realize a carbon-recycling society.

CASE STUDY
1. LASOLV
Recently in the field of quantum computing, Ising computing
been proposed as a method based on entirely different
concepts than quantum computing with quantum gates. To
create a computer capable of handling many optimization
problems, we built a "coherent Ising machine," which is a
new Ising computer using light. Our experiment demonstrated
2000-node computation and has been proven to have
extremely fast computing power. Creation of a coherent Ising
machine means faster solutions to optimization problems
in an era when various systems that make up society, such
as communication networks, transportation networks, and
social networks, are becoming larger and more complex.
Already in regards to certain problems, quantum technology
has the potential to outper for m conventional digital
computers, and we will continue to collaborate across fields
with mathematicians and software researchers in order to
demonstrate this superiority.

2. Proof-of-principle
experiment of
quantum repeaters
with all photonics
In collaboration with Osaka Universit y,
Toyama University and the University of
Toronto, we were the first in the world
to stage a successful proof-of-principle
experiment for the purpose of creating
quantum repeaters. This experiment
demonstrated the theoretical basis for an
all-photonic quantum repeater protocol that
could enable a worldwide quantum network using only with optical devices. The quantum Internet that quantum repeaters would
make possible is considered the holy grail of information processing networks, with potential applications far beyond the current
Internet. The effort to replace all conventional communication devices underlying the Internet with optical devices is closely
tied to the concept of an all-photonic network and holds promise for an energy-efficient high-speed Internet. Our successful
demonstration of this principle experimentally is regarded as a first big step for humanity towards the realization of a worldwide
all-photonic quantum Internet.

CASE STUDY
1. “hitoe” cloth that measures biomedical signals
In 2016, NTT DoCoMo and Goldwin collaborated to create
innerwear that measures biomedical signals. Heart rate and
ECG signals can be measured just by wearing the clothing,
which is mainly used to manage sports training and improve
performance. This innerwear uses the functional material
called "hitoe" jointly developed by Toray Industries and NTT.
Composed of ultrafine fibers, the material features highly
adhesive bioelectrodes and high moisture retention. In the
future it is expected to be used not only in the field of sports
but also to monitor physical condition. Observers are closely
watching this material with expectations including use as
a personnel management tool for workers in dangerous
fields and long-distance bus, truck, and nighttime drivers, as
well as for clothing that can prevent accidents such as heat
stroke.

2. Creation of microwell nanobiodevices


Membrane proteins, which have attracted
attention as "post-genome" biotechnology,
have been considered difficult to use. If
simply placed atop a substrate, the protein
structure will break down due to the
interaction with the substrate. Therefore,
NT T recreated a cell-like environment
on a semiconductor, and constructed a
microwell structure several micrometers in
diameter on a substrate. Each well is about
as large as a cell. Placing membrane
proteins here made it possible to perform
various experiments and measurements. If
nanobiodevices that integrate membrane
proteins and semiconduc tor devices
become reality, they are expected make contributions in many fields including medicine and environmental applications. This
miniature well-shaped substrate will make it possible to unravel the mechanisms of biomedical information at the molecular level
and treat intractable diseases.

CASE STUDY
1. Semiconductor hetero-nanowire
Current semiconductor devices
are in widespread use in
computers and communications
equipment. One of the basic
structures of these devices is
known as a hetero-structure,
in which dif ferent t ypes of
semiconductors are joined
together. It was previously taken
for granted that the constituent
semiconductors of hetero-
structures were limited in type
and joined along 2D surfaces.
By utilizing a structure known as a semiconductor nanowire, we are working to overturn these limits and develop new production
technology for hetero-structures. Already, we have created light-emitting diodes and laser structures using semiconductor
nanowire structures that function as devices. These new, groundbreaking semiconductor devices could result in breakthrough
applications not only in information processing devices such as computers and mobile phones, but also transmission and
receiving devices for telecommunications technology.

2 . Forma t ion of arbit rar y 3D st ruc tures t ha t are hig hly


biocompatible
In the fields of drug discovery,
regenerative medicine,
a n d t ra n s p l a n t p ro c e d u re s ,
technology is demanded that
can build up cells into three -
d i m e n s i o n a l s t r u c t u re s a n d
ar tif icially create st r uc tures
that are akin to biological
tissue. Past research has used
methods such as predetermined arrangement of cells and semiconductor nano-fabrication technology, but faced problems with
the precision of fabrication and biocompatibility. We have used hydrogel with high biocompatibility to create technology that
independently builds up three-dimensional forms. Using this technology, we have succeeded in encapsulating and cultivating
cells inside the three-dimensional forms, thereby artificially creating a structure similar to biological tissue. This method makes
it possible to produce three-dimensional structures with a high degree of design freedom, as well as cultivate cardiomyocytes
inside the structure. These efforts not only promise to dramatically advance analysis of single cells, but also have potential for
new biointerfaces.
